38 typedef enum pa_source_output_state {
39 PA_SOURCE_OUTPUT_INIT,
40 PA_SOURCE_OUTPUT_RUNNING,
41 PA_SOURCE_OUTPUT_CORKED,
42 PA_SOURCE_OUTPUT_UNLINKED
43 } pa_source_output_state_t;
44
45 static inline pa_bool_t PA_SOURCE_OUTPUT_IS_LINKED(pa_source_output_state_t x) {
46 return x == PA_SOURCE_OUTPUT_RUNNING || x == PA_SOURCE_OUTPUT_CORKED;
47 }
48
49 typedef enum pa_source_output_flags {
50 PA_SOURCE_OUTPUT_VARIABLE_RATE = 1,
51 PA_SOURCE_OUTPUT_DONT_MOVE = 2,
52 PA_SOURCE_OUTPUT_START_CORKED = 4,
53 PA_SOURCE_OUTPUT_NO_REMAP = 8,
54 PA_SOURCE_OUTPUT_NO_REMIX = 16,
55 PA_SOURCE_OUTPUT_FIX_FORMAT = 32,
56 PA_SOURCE_OUTPUT_FIX_RATE = 64,
57 PA_SOURCE_OUTPUT_FIX_CHANNELS = 128
58 } pa_source_output_flags_t;
59
60 struct pa_source_output {
61 pa_msgobject parent;
62
63 uint32_t index;
64 pa_core *core;
65
66 pa_source_output_state_t state;
67 pa_source_output_flags_t flags;
68
69 pa_proplist *proplist;
70 char *driver; /* may be NULL */
71 pa_module *module; /* may be NULL */
72 pa_client *client; /* may be NULL */
73
74 pa_source *source;
75
76 /* A source output can monitor just a single input of a sink, in which case we find it here */
77 pa_sink_input *direct_on_input; /* may be NULL */
78
79 pa_sample_spec sample_spec;
80 pa_channel_map channel_map;
81
82 pa_resample_method_t resample_method;
83
84 /* Pushes a new memchunk into the output. Called from IO thread
85 * context. */
86 void (*push)(pa_source_output *o, const pa_memchunk *chunk);
87
88 /* Only relevant for monitor sources right now: called when the
89 * recorded stream is rewound. Called from IO context*/
90 void (*process_rewind)(pa_source_output *o, size_t nbytes);
91
92 /* Called whenever the maximum rewindable size of the source
93 * changes. Called from IO thread context. */
94 void (*update_max_rewind) (pa_source_output *o, size_t nbytes); /* may be NULL */
95
96 /* If non-NULL this function is called when the output is first
97 * connected to a source. Called from IO thread context */
98 void (*attach) (pa_source_output *o); /* may be NULL */
99
100 /* If non-NULL this function is called when the output is
101 * disconnected from its source. Called from IO thread context */
102 void (*detach) (pa_source_output *o); /* may be NULL */
103
104 /* If non-NULL called whenever the the source this output is attached
105 * to suspends or resumes. Called from main context */
106 void (*suspend) (pa_source_output *o, pa_bool_t b); /* may be NULL */
107
108 /* If non-NULL called whenever the the source this output is attached
109 * to changes. Called from main context */
110 void (*moved) (pa_source_output *o); /* may be NULL */
111
112 /* Supposed to unlink and destroy this stream. Called from main
113 * context. */
114 void (*kill)(pa_source_output* o); /* may be NULL */
115
116 /* Return the current latency (i.e. length of bufferd audio) of
117 this stream. Called from main context. If NULL a
118 PA_SOURCE_OUTPUT_MESSAGE_GET_LATENCY message is sent to the IO
119 thread instead. */
120 pa_usec_t (*get_latency) (pa_source_output *o); /* may be NULL */
121
122 /* If non_NULL this function is called from thread context if the
123 * state changes. The old state is found in thread_info.state. */
124 void (*state_change) (pa_source_output *o, pa_source_output_state_t state); /* may be NULL */
125
126 struct {
127 pa_source_output_state_t state;
128
129 pa_bool_t attached; /* True only between ->attach() and ->detach() calls */
130
131 pa_sample_spec sample_spec;
132
133 pa_resampler* resampler; /* may be NULL */
134
135 /* We maintain a delay memblockq here for source outputs that
136 * don't implement rewind() */
137 pa_memblockq *delay_memblockq;
138
139 /* The requested latency for the source */
140 pa_usec_t requested_source_latency;
141
142 pa_sink_input *direct_on_input; /* may be NULL */
143 } thread_info;
144
145 void *userdata;
146 };
